What Does Water Symbolize in Feng Shui?

Water in feng shui represents more than just a physical element. It symbolizes wealth, career success, energy flow, adaptability, and the ability to make important decisions. The presence of water in a space brings calm and tranquil energy, promoting balance and harmony. Moreover, the water element is associated with the career and life path area of your home or office.

Feng Shui Water Element Colors

Certain colors are closely associated with the water element in feng shui. These colors are believed to enhance the energy of the water element and promote its qualities. The colors linked with the water element are:

  • Black: Represents still and reflective water and is associated with wealth and power.
  • Blue: Represents the flow of water and is associated with communication and adaptability.
  • Dark purple: Represents the depth and mystery of water and is associated with financial abundance and power.
  • Silver: Represents wealth and prosperity.

Please note that these color associations are general guidelines. The overall design and context of your space should be taken into consideration. For more personalized advice, it is recommended to consult a professional feng shui consultant.

Feng Shui Water Element Placement Tips

To harness the benefits of the feng shui water element, here are some placement tips you can follow:

  • Place water features such as fountains and waterfalls in your home or workplace.
  • Use symbols of water like sculptures, wall art, or hangings.
  • Incorporate the color black or other dark colors to retain the energy of water in certain areas.
  • Ensure that every water feature is clean and functioning properly.
  • Create a relaxing atmosphere by incorporating the sound of water.
  • Position the water feature in a way that reflects light, enhancing the energy of the space.
